What size stud is right
Men's diamond studs typically run from 0.25ct to 1.00ct per stone. A 0.25ct stone per ear produces a clean, understated look. At 0.50ct and above, the stone becomes clearly visible at conversational distance. Carat weight alone does not tell you the spread: a well-cut stone measures larger face-up than a deep stone of the same weight.
Setting styles for studs
Bezel settings fully encase the girdle and are the most secure for daily wear and active lifestyles. Martini or three-prong settings give a lighter look and allow more light into the stone. Four-prong settings are common and hold the stone firmly. Push-back and screw-back fittings both work; screw-backs reduce loss risk but take longer to put on.
Stone grades that matter for studs
For a stud, eye-clean clarity matters more than a high certificate grade. Near-colourless (G-J) in white metal suits most buyers. Avoid very low cut grades: a poorly cut stone in a stud will look dark at the face even if the certificate grade is high. Fluorescence is less of an issue in stud settings than in large face-up stones.

Decision table
Use the details, not a shortcut.
| Carat per stone | Face-up diameter (round) | Typical read at distance |
|---|---|---|
| 0.25ct | Approx 4.1mm | Subtle, understated |
| 0.50ct | Approx 5.2mm | Clearly visible, versatile |
| 0.75ct | Approx 5.9mm | Statement piece |
| 1.00ct | Approx 6.5mm | Prominent, high price jump |
| 1.50ct+ | Approx 7.4mm+ | Significant investment; certification essential |

What size diamond stud is most popular for men?
0.25ct to 0.50ct per stone covers most purchases. Larger sizes exist but the price jumps are significant at 0.50ct and 1.00ct thresholds.
Do men's diamond studs need a certificate?
At 0.25ct and below per stone, certificates are uncommon. At 0.50ct and above, a GIA or recognised lab certificate protects the buyer on quality and resale.
What is the difference between a push-back and screw-back?
A push-back clips on and is faster to use. A screw-back threads on and is more secure, reducing the chance of losing the earring. Screw-backs are worth the minor inconvenience for higher-value studs.
Should I buy white gold or platinum for diamond studs?
White gold is more common and less expensive. Platinum is denser and more durable over time. Both show diamond colour well. White gold requires periodic rhodium re-plating to maintain its bright appearance.
Can I resell diamond studs later?
Certified natural diamond studs from reputable dealers resell better than uncertified stones. Bring the certificate and original documentation when approaching a buyer.
